Just a short advice for owners of GF 8800 Gt graphic cards. If you decide to overclock your card, please consider a buying new cooling for your card (single slot cooler is to weak for OC). I have both my self a ZALMAN, VF900 Cu cooler and it works magnificently! Price for my cooler was around 40$ (in Croatia, I don't know, what is price elsewhere), and it took me 15min to install it . Temperatures of my graphic card have doped for almost 20 degrees Celsius, with overclocking!!! and this card when overclocked, is almost as fast as 8800 GTS 512MB, if not faster, an it makes less noise.
